Using a Walking Pad and Standing Desk Properly

A standing or walking pad as well as a standing desks are a great way to ease back pain, improve circulation, and keep your heart healthy while at work. The right choice is crucial, however.

You should select a walking pad that fits your space and is made for your body build. You'll have the same issues when you stand in a stationary position as you would if sitting all day.

Reduces Joint Stiffness

During the COVID-19 pandemic, many people worked from home and they realized that sitting for long periods of time was not healthy for their backs. Some even employed treadmill desks to reduce the health risks associated with sitting for long periods of time. While these desks can be a great solution however, it's essential to understand how to use them correctly to avoid stiff joints and improve productivity.

If people sit for long periods of time, it restricts blood flow to their feet and legs, which can lead to varicose veins and swelling. Moving your posture and standing frequently allows the muscles of your feet and legs to relax and contract, which helps to circulate the blood, reducing discomfort and pain. When used in conjunction with a treadmill for under desk desk, walking pads help to keep your joints supple and flexible throughout the day.

Many people who spend all day working on computers experience muscles strain, which may cause pains in their shoulders, neck and lower back. They may also have problems with their elbows, wrists and hands. Poor posture and bad habits like rounding shoulders or hunching when typing can lead to these issues. A standing desk as well as a walking pad can assist to avoid these issues and increase productivity.

Standing all day can be a strain on your knees, particularly if you're wearing shoes that are uncomfortable. A hard surface pressing down on your feet can cause knee pain. A cushioned mat can be added to your standing desk to help spread the weight of your feet over the entire surface. This will help prevent injuries.

A rigid kneecap can also cause knee pain when working at the computer. This condition can cause stiffness, pain and arthritis. Utilizing a walking pad and making sure your chair is adjusted to the correct height can help avoid this issue by keeping your knees in a more neutral position. Additionally having frequent breaks to walk around can help.

Productivity Rises

A standing desk and walking pad can help you boost your productivity if work a lot at your desk. They can help you move as you work. This improves your blood circulation and keeps you alert and focused. They can also help you burn more calories and lose weight and are an effective way to boost your health and fitness while at work.

Many people struggle to get enough exercise during the day due to busy schedules and long working hours. They can be affected by a variety of health issues, including back pain and obesity, because they sit for long periods of time. But treadmill desks can assist you in overcoming these issues and make your workday more productive.

Studies show that those who use treadmill desks are less stressed and more productive. They are also more creative than their counterparts. This is due to the fact that walking can increase the growth of new brain cells, which increases your mental alertness and boosts your memory. Regularly exercising can reduce the chance of developing depression and cognitive decline.

It is essential to take regular breaks while sitting and standing all through the day to ensure that you can work effectively. It's also important to monitor your posture and adjust the level of your pad for walking as required to avoid strain on your legs and back.

When you are choosing a treadmill for walking, be sure to select one that is small and light. It's easy to transport and fit under your desk. It is also essential to choose a model that is quiet, which means it will not disturb your colleagues.

A treadmill that folds under the desk is a great option for smaller living spaces. It is easy to move and can be used anywhere in the home office or at a house shared with a friend. The WalkingPad A1 Pro folds down to 4.7 inches thick, which makes it perfect for small spaces. It's also highly stable and secure, so you can rest assured that it won't tip over.

Burns Calories

It takes a while to get used to standing up while working, but it can help reduce neck and back discomfort. It also improves levels of energy and improves posture. In a study conducted in a call center where employees sat at desks that could stand were less prone to back pain and were more productive than their colleagues who used regular desks. This is no surprise since prolonged sitting has been linked to a variety of health risks, including obesity as well as heart disease.

A standing desk can burn up to 200 calories more per day than a traditional workstation. This is due to the fact that you are required to move more frequently than when you sit down. It also requires you to move your legs and work your core muscles, which leads to a more vigorous metabolism. The good thing is that it's simpler and more affordable to make use of a standing desk than it is to join an exercise facility to work out.

While you'll burn more calories standing but it's important to keep in mind that it's not an exercise substitute and will only put only a tiny difference in your calories if are overweight. Standing desks can cause pain in your joints and feet when you stand for too long. You can purchase a standing mat that can elevate the chair's surface and relieve pressure on your legs and feet.

Reduces Noise

Many people are interested in walking while working but aren't sure how to integrate it into their daily routine. The walking pads available for purchase let you walk in a quiet, non-distracting manner without affecting your ability to complete your tasks.

These mats under desks are smaller and can be placed beneath your desk, unlike more bulky exercise equipment such as treadmills. They are also quieter, making them ideal for use in offices. Some even come with wheels for easy movement or storage when not in use.

The motor of the under-desk pads is constructed to create a minimal noise when walking or running. This is crucial because a noisy pad could disturb you while trying to concentrate on your work. A loud pad may cause fatigue and decrease your effectiveness.

Avoid this by looking for models that have a powerful motor that can handle your work requirements while maintaining an uninhibited noise level. Examine the material of the belt and whether it can absorb shocks and impacts.

With a little effort you can learn to walk and work simultaneously. However, remember that working while walking treadmill under desk can make certain fine motor-skill tasks more difficult. If you're just starting out, it's better to start with easy tasks, and then gradually increase the amount of work you do.

In addition to being ergonomic and comfortable Walking during work is also proven to improve your cognitive health. According to studies, walking 9.800 steps per day can reduce your risk of dementia by half. Therefore, it's important to find an opportunity to integrate walking into your routine and break free from a sedentary life.
